Abstract

See full text

A method for operating a superconducting device (1; 1a, 1b), having a coated conductor (2) with a substrate (3) and a quenchable superconducting film (4), wherein the coated conductor (2) has a width W and a length L, is characterized in that 0.5≦L/W≦10, in particular 0.5≦L/W≦8, and that the coated conductor (2) has an engineering resistivity ρeng shunting the superconducting film (4) in a quenched state, with ρeng>2.5 Ω, wherein RIntShunteng*L/W, with RIntShunt: internal shunt resistance of the coated conductor (2). The risk of a burnout of a superconducting device in case of a quench in its superconducting film is thereby further reduced to such an extent that the device can be operated without use of an additional external shunt.
